The Raga deep dive courses are aimed at internalising Raga concepts. In this Raga Deepdive course the ancient early morning Raga Bhairav is explored. Bhairav has a simple structure as an outline, but has a Raga roop that is ornamented with Meend, Andolan and the accurate lagaav of Sur and Kan Swar. Perfect Sur in the notes of this Raga can be achieved by complete focus and Swar Sadhana. Bhairav is a major Raga in the modern and ancient Raga systems.

Objectives

To practise singing the Raga Chalan of Bhairav

To do Swar Sadhana in Raga Bhairav

To create and sing the Swar Vistar in Bhairav

To learn and practise singing the Alankar/Paltas in Bhairav

To learn a Chhota Khayal with Aalap and Taan in Raga Bhairav

To review the Chhota Khayal already learnt in Bhairav (if any)

To learn a Bada Khayal in Raga Bhairav

To sing Aalap within the Bada Khayal.

To sing Sargam and Taan in Bada Khayal

To develop awareness about related Ragas

To learn a composition in another Taal  with improvisation
